Overview of Melamine Cyanurate

Melamine cyanurate is a halogen-free flame retardant that is widely used in various industries for its excellent thermal stability and high efficiency in reducing flammability. It is a white, crystalline powder consisting of melamine and cyanuric acid, forming a complex through hydrogen bonding. This synergistic combination results in a flame-retardant system that is particularly effective in preventing the spread of fire in polymer materials.

Due to its non-toxic nature and ability to meet stringent fire safety regulations, melamine cyanurate has gained popularity in sectors such as electronics, construction, textiles, and automotive. Its compatibility with a wide range of polymers, including polyamides, polypropylene, and polyethylene, makes it a versatile choice for enhancing the fire resistance of various products. Manufacturers appreciate its thermal stability and low smoke emission properties, making it a preferred choice for applications requiring high-performance flame retardancy.

Properties of Melamine Cyanurate

Melamine cyanurate, a white crystalline powder, is a halogen-free flame retardant known for its excellent thermal stability. It exhibits low solubility in water and most organic solvents, making it highly suitable for various applications. Melamine cyanurate's chemical structure allows for strong intumescence properties, enabling it to swell and form a protective char layer when exposed to heat or flames. This char layer acts as a barrier, reducing heat and mass transfer, thereby suppressing combustion and delaying ignition.

Moreover, melamine cyanurate is characterized by its high decomposition temperature, typically above 400°C. This thermal stability makes it a preferred choice in applications where high temperatures are a concern. Additionally, melamine cyanurate demonstrates good compatibility with a wide range of polymers, including polypropylene, polyethylene, and polyamide. Its ability to maintain mechanical properties of the polymer while imparting flame-retardant properties makes it a versatile additive in industries such as electrical and electronics, construction, and automotive.

Uses of Melamine Cyanurate

Melamine cyanurate finds widespread applications across various industries due to its exceptional fire-retardant properties. One of its primary uses is in the manufacturing of plastics, especially in polyamide and polyolefin systems. The addition of melamine cyanurate helps enhance the flame retardancy of these materials, making them suitable for a wide range of applications where fire safety is a critical factor. Additionally, melamine cyanurate is utilized in cable and wire insulation to improve their fire-resistant properties, thus ensuring safer electrical installations in buildings and vehicles.

Moreover, the use of melamine cyanurate extends to the production of textiles, where it is incorporated into fabrics to enhance their flame retardancy. This application is particularly important in industries where fire safety regulations are stringent, such as in the automotive and aviation sectors. By incorporating melamine cyanurate into textiles, manufacturers can ensure that their products meet the required safety standards while maintaining the desired aesthetic and functional qualities.
